Have a chat with your CDC and they will advise the best solution, the Dr's signature should just mean that you can't do SS (unless there are other medical reasons you need a signature), there are other parts of the plan you can follow and then move to SS.

Pinkbutterfly you only need permission from your Dr to go on sole source. You could do one of the other plans to get your BMI under 40, especially if you don't have far to go, then switch to sole source once you reach it. Definitely speak to the cousellor agan. x x x
